In February Trump told reporters he had NO dealing with Russia. “And I have no loans with Russia. I have no loans with Russia at all.”
Yet in 2013, after Trump addressed potential investors in Moscow, he bragged to Real Estate Weekly about his access to Russia’s rich and powerful. “I have a great relationship with many Russians, and almost all of the oligarchs were in the room.” http://www.usatoday.com/story/news/world/2017/03/28/trump-business-past-ties-russian-mobsters-organized-crime/98321252/
In 2008 in Moscow, Donald Trump Jr. told Russian media that “Russians make up a pretty disproportionate cross section of a lot of our assets.” New York City real estate broker Dolly Lenz told USA TODAY she sold about 65 condos to Russian investors in Trump World, Manhattan and that, many sought personal meetings with Trump for his business expertise. “They all wanted to meet Donald. They became very friendly.” Lenz said many of those meetings happened in Trump’s office at Trump Tower or at sales events.

Medicaid expansion referendum headed to Maine ballot
By Christopher Cousins, BDN Staff
AUGUSTA, Maine — Mainers will vote in November on whether the state should expand its Medicaid program, following the validation Tuesday of a petition to do so.
…………………..
The citizen-initiated bill, An Act to Enhance Access to Affordable Health Care, seeks for Maine to provide Medicaid services through MaineCare to qualifying people younger than 65 years old, whose income is below 133 percent plus 5 percent of the nonfarm income official poverty line.
